當(dāng)前位置: 首頁 > 會(huì)話管理
-
PHP 會(huì)話管理的安全策略
為了確保PHP會(huì)話管理的安全,必須實(shí)施以下安全策略:使用安全的Cookie(HTTPS傳輸,帶有HttpOnly和Secure標(biāo)志)設(shè)置合理的會(huì)話生命周期使用會(huì)話再生防止會(huì)話劫持禁止跨站點(diǎn)請(qǐng)求偽造(CSRF),例如使用反CSRF令牌使用數(shù)據(jù)庫存儲(chǔ)會(huì)話數(shù)據(jù),而不是文件存儲(chǔ)
php教程 12662024-05-02 17:45:01
-
Java Servlet如何實(shí)現(xiàn)會(huì)話管理?
JavaServlet會(huì)話管理允許服務(wù)器在HTTP無狀態(tài)協(xié)議中維護(hù)會(huì)話狀態(tài)。通過使用HttpSession接口可以創(chuàng)建、訪問和銷毀會(huì)話。會(huì)話數(shù)據(jù)存儲(chǔ)在會(huì)話屬性中,并且可以使用SSL/TLS來保護(hù)會(huì)話免遭竊取。常見的實(shí)際案例包括電子商務(wù)中的購物車管理和根據(jù)用戶首選項(xiàng)個(gè)性化主頁。
java教程 10202024-04-16 17:48:02
-
PHP開始新的或恢復(fù)現(xiàn)有的會(huì)話
這篇文章將為大家詳細(xì)講解有關(guān)PHP開始新的或恢復(fù)現(xiàn)有的會(huì)話,小編覺得挺實(shí)用的,因此分享給大家做個(gè)參考,希望大家閱讀完這篇文章后可以有所收獲。PHP會(huì)話管理:啟動(dòng)新會(huì)話或恢復(fù)現(xiàn)有會(huì)話簡介會(huì)話管理在php中至關(guān)重要,它允許您在用戶會(huì)話期間存儲(chǔ)和訪問用戶數(shù)據(jù)。本文將詳細(xì)介紹如何在PHP中啟動(dòng)新會(huì)話或恢復(fù)現(xiàn)有會(huì)話。啟動(dòng)新會(huì)話該函數(shù)session_start()會(huì)檢查是否存在會(huì)話,如果沒有,則它會(huì)創(chuàng)建一個(gè)新的會(huì)話。它還可以讀取會(huì)話數(shù)據(jù)并將其
php教程 12052024-03-21 10:26:58
-
PHP獲得和/或設(shè)置當(dāng)前會(huì)話模塊
這篇文章將為大家詳細(xì)講解有關(guān)PHP獲得和/或設(shè)置當(dāng)前會(huì)話模塊,小編覺得挺實(shí)用的,因此分享給大家做個(gè)參考,希望大家閱讀完這篇文章后可以有所收獲。PHP會(huì)話模塊會(huì)話模塊用于在多個(gè)請(qǐng)求之間存儲(chǔ)和檢索用戶特定信息。php提供了內(nèi)置會(huì)話模塊,用于管理這種會(huì)話數(shù)據(jù)。獲得當(dāng)前會(huì)話模塊要獲得當(dāng)前會(huì)話模塊,可以使用session_start()函數(shù)。這將啟動(dòng)一個(gè)會(huì)話,并創(chuàng)建一個(gè)$_SESSION超級(jí)全局變量,用于存儲(chǔ)會(huì)話數(shù)據(jù)。session_start();設(shè)置當(dāng)前會(huì)話模塊要設(shè)置當(dāng)前會(huì)話模塊,可以使用以下函數(shù):s
php教程 7712024-03-21 09:50:40
-
PHP更新新生成的會(huì)話標(biāo)識(shí)
這篇文章將為大家詳細(xì)講解有關(guān)PHP更新新生成的會(huì)話標(biāo)識(shí),小編覺得挺實(shí)用的,因此分享給大家做個(gè)參考,希望大家閱讀完這篇文章后可以有所收獲。PHP更新新生成的會(huì)話標(biāo)識(shí)簡介會(huì)話標(biāo)識(shí)是一個(gè)唯一字符串,用于在用戶請(qǐng)求之間識(shí)別和跟蹤會(huì)話。php使用多種方法來生成和更新會(huì)話標(biāo)識(shí)。會(huì)話標(biāo)識(shí)的生成默認(rèn)方法:由PHP自動(dòng)生成一個(gè)32字節(jié)隨機(jī)字符串,并存儲(chǔ)在名為session_id的cookie中。自定義方法:開發(fā)人員可以使用session_id()函數(shù)生成一個(gè)自定義會(huì)話標(biāo)識(shí)。哈希:PHP還可以使用哈希函數(shù)(如MD5
php教程 11552024-03-21 09:06:28
-
函數(shù)包羅萬象:從簡單到復(fù)雜的 PHP 函數(shù)
簡單函數(shù)會(huì)話管理:session_start()函數(shù)啟動(dòng)一個(gè)會(huì)話,允許跨多個(gè)頁面存儲(chǔ)用戶數(shù)據(jù)。代碼:session_start();$_SESSION["username"]="JohnDoe";字符串操作:strpos()函數(shù)在字符串中查找指定子字符串的位置。代碼:$string="HelloWorld";$position=strpos($string,"World");//結(jié)果:6數(shù)據(jù)操作:array_merge()函數(shù)將兩個(gè)或多個(gè)數(shù)組合并為一個(gè)數(shù)組。代碼:$array1=[1,2,3];
php教程 10572024-03-02 21:46:05
-
ThinkPHP開發(fā)注意事項(xiàng):合理使用會(huì)話管理功能
ThinkPHP是一款優(yōu)秀的PHP開發(fā)框架,它提供了許多強(qiáng)大的功能和工具,幫助開發(fā)人員更高效地構(gòu)建Web應(yīng)用程序。其中一個(gè)非常重要的功能是會(huì)話管理,它可以幫助我們跟蹤用戶的狀態(tài)和信息。然而,合理使用會(huì)話管理功能是至關(guān)重要的,本文將介紹一些注意事項(xiàng)和最佳實(shí)踐。首先,我們應(yīng)該明確會(huì)話管理的目的。會(huì)話管理主要用于跟蹤用戶的狀態(tài)和信息,以便在用戶訪問Web應(yīng)用程序時(shí)
ThinkPHP 15122023-11-23 09:56:09
-
Redis如何實(shí)現(xiàn)分布式會(huì)話管理
Redis如何實(shí)現(xiàn)分布式會(huì)話管理,需要具體代碼示例分布式會(huì)話管理是當(dāng)下互聯(lián)網(wǎng)熱門話題之一,面對(duì)高并發(fā)、大數(shù)據(jù)量的場景,傳統(tǒng)的會(huì)話管理方式逐漸顯得力不從心。Redis作為一個(gè)高性能的鍵值數(shù)據(jù)庫,提供了分布式會(huì)話管理的解決方案。本文將介紹如何使用Redis實(shí)現(xiàn)分布式會(huì)話管理,并給出具體的代碼示例。一、Redis作為分布式會(huì)話存儲(chǔ)介紹傳統(tǒng)的會(huì)話管理方式是將會(huì)話信
Redis 13092023-11-07 11:10:47
-
如何解決PHP開發(fā)中的會(huì)話管理和狀態(tài)維護(hù)
如何解決PHP開發(fā)中的會(huì)話管理和狀態(tài)維護(hù),需要具體代碼示例對(duì)于PHP開發(fā)者來說,會(huì)話管理和狀態(tài)維護(hù)是非常重要的一部分。通過會(huì)話管理,我們可以在多個(gè)頁面間共享數(shù)據(jù),保持用戶登錄狀態(tài),以及實(shí)現(xiàn)購物車、表單數(shù)據(jù)的持久化等功能。在本文中,我們將探討如何解決PHP開發(fā)中的會(huì)話管理和狀態(tài)維護(hù)問題,并提供一些具體的代碼示例。使用PHP的內(nèi)置會(huì)話管理函數(shù)PHP提供了一些內(nèi)置
php教程 7772023-10-10 10:53:02
-
如何使用Redis和PHP開發(fā)用戶會(huì)話管理功能
如何使用Redis和PHP開發(fā)用戶會(huì)話管理功能導(dǎo)語:用戶會(huì)話管理是Web應(yīng)用開發(fā)中一個(gè)重要的功能,它可以幫助我們追蹤和管理用戶登錄狀態(tài),同時(shí)提供安全的身份驗(yàn)證和授權(quán)功能。在本文中,我們將介紹如何使用Redis和PHP來實(shí)現(xiàn)用戶會(huì)話管理功能,并附上具體的代碼示例。一、什么是Redis?Redis(RemoteDictionaryServer)是一個(gè)開源的高
Redis 14252023-09-20 08:19:41
-
PHP底層開發(fā)原理詳解:會(huì)話管理和狀態(tài)保持
PHP底層開發(fā)原理詳解:會(huì)話管理和狀態(tài)保持在開發(fā)Web應(yīng)用程序過程中,會(huì)話管理和狀態(tài)保持是非常重要的概念。會(huì)話管理是指在用戶訪問網(wǎng)站時(shí),服務(wù)器如何識(shí)別和跟蹤用戶的身份和狀態(tài)。狀態(tài)保持則是指服務(wù)器如何保持用戶的狀態(tài)信息,以便在不同請(qǐng)求之間共享和使用。一、會(huì)話管理會(huì)話的概念會(huì)話是指用戶與服務(wù)器之間的一種交互方式,通過會(huì)話,服務(wù)器可以跟蹤用戶在網(wǎng)站上的行為。典
php教程 9072023-09-10 17:13:46
-
深入研究PHP底層開發(fā)原理:會(huì)話管理和狀態(tài)保持策略分享
深入研究PHP底層開發(fā)原理:會(huì)話管理和狀態(tài)保持策略分享引言:在Web開發(fā)中,會(huì)話管理和狀態(tài)保持是非常重要的兩個(gè)概念。而在PHP底層開發(fā)中,了解和掌握相關(guān)的原理和策略,對(duì)于開發(fā)安全、高效的應(yīng)用程序至關(guān)重要。本文將詳細(xì)探討PHP底層會(huì)話管理和狀態(tài)保持的原理,并分享一些實(shí)用的策略和代碼示例。一、會(huì)話管理的原理會(huì)話管理是指在Web應(yīng)用程序中維護(hù)用戶狀態(tài)的過程。PHP
php教程 11962023-09-09 15:09:43
-
深入研究PHP底層開發(fā)原理:會(huì)話管理和狀態(tài)保持方法
深入研究PHP底層開發(fā)原理:會(huì)話管理和狀態(tài)保持方法前言在現(xiàn)代的Web開發(fā)中,會(huì)話管理和狀態(tài)保持是非常重要的部分。無論是用戶登錄狀態(tài)的保持,還是購物車等狀態(tài)的維護(hù),都需要借助會(huì)話管理和狀態(tài)保持技術(shù)。而在PHP底層開發(fā)中,我們需要了解會(huì)話管理和狀態(tài)保持的原理與方法,以便更好地設(shè)計(jì)和調(diào)優(yōu)我們的Web應(yīng)用程序。會(huì)話管理基礎(chǔ)會(huì)話(session)指的是客戶端與服務(wù)器端
php教程 16672023-09-08 13:31:47
-
PHP網(wǎng)站安全:如何防止會(huì)話劫持?
PHP網(wǎng)站安全:如何防止會(huì)話劫持?簡介:隨著互聯(lián)網(wǎng)的發(fā)展,各種類型的網(wǎng)站應(yīng)用層出不窮。而隨著網(wǎng)站的發(fā)展,網(wǎng)站安全問題也變得越來越重要。其中,會(huì)話劫持是一種常見的攻擊方式。本文將介紹會(huì)話劫持的概念,并提供幾種有效的方式來防范會(huì)話劫持,保護(hù)網(wǎng)站的安全性。一、會(huì)話劫持的概念會(huì)話劫持是指攻擊者通過某種手段獲取到合法用戶的會(huì)話ID,并使用該會(huì)話ID冒充合法用戶,從而執(zhí)
php教程 18192023-08-17 18:06:27
-
Python實(shí)現(xiàn)無頭瀏覽器采集應(yīng)用的頁面自動(dòng)登錄與會(huì)話管理功能剖析
Python實(shí)現(xiàn)無頭瀏覽器采集應(yīng)用的頁面自動(dòng)登錄與會(huì)話管理功能剖析引言:隨著互聯(lián)網(wǎng)的快速發(fā)展,我們的生活越來越離不開網(wǎng)絡(luò)應(yīng)用。而對(duì)于很多網(wǎng)頁類型的應(yīng)用,我們需要手動(dòng)進(jìn)行登錄才能獲取更多的信息或操作某些功能。為了提高效率,我們可以通過自動(dòng)化腳本實(shí)現(xiàn)頁面自動(dòng)登錄與會(huì)話管理的功能。無頭瀏覽器:在實(shí)現(xiàn)頁面自動(dòng)登錄與會(huì)話管理功能之前,我們首先需要了解什么是無頭瀏覽器。
Python教程 14492023-08-09 19:06:18
-
Java中的會(huì)話固定攻擊與保護(hù)
Java中的會(huì)話固定攻擊與保護(hù)在網(wǎng)絡(luò)應(yīng)用程序中,會(huì)話是一種重要的機(jī)制,用于跟蹤和管理用戶在網(wǎng)站上的活動(dòng)。它通過在服務(wù)器和客戶端之間存儲(chǔ)會(huì)話數(shù)據(jù)來實(shí)現(xiàn)。然而,會(huì)話固定攻擊是一種安全威脅,它利用了會(huì)話標(biāo)識(shí)符來獲取非法訪問權(quán)限。在本文中,我們將討論Java中的會(huì)話固定攻擊,并提供一些保護(hù)機(jī)制的代碼示例。會(huì)話固定攻擊是指攻擊者在注入惡意代碼或通過其他方式竊取合法用戶
java教程 16552023-08-08 14:41:07
社區(qū)問答
-
vue3+tp6怎么加入微信公眾號(hào)啊
閱讀:4821 · 5個(gè)月前
-
RPC模式
閱讀:4922 · 7個(gè)月前
-
insert時(shí),如何避免重復(fù)注冊(cè)?
閱讀:5725 · 8個(gè)月前
-
vite 啟動(dòng)項(xiàng)目報(bào)錯(cuò) 不管用yarn 還是cnpm
閱讀:6323 · 10個(gè)月前
最新文章
-
vivo V30 Pro充電速度太慢怎么辦 vivo V30 Pro快充功能開啟技巧
閱讀:388 · 7分鐘前
-
如何在Golang中優(yōu)化HTTP服務(wù)器性能
閱讀:201 · 7分鐘前
-
自媒體內(nèi)容怎么保持持續(xù)更新_自媒體持續(xù)更新內(nèi)容的有效方法
閱讀:760 · 8分鐘前
-
mysql服務(wù)安裝后如何進(jìn)行基本性能調(diào)優(yōu)
閱讀:642 · 8分鐘前
-
PHP命令行參數(shù)怎么解析_PHP $argv全局變量與getopt函數(shù)解析參數(shù)
閱讀:919 · 9分鐘前
-
Chrome瀏覽器如何查看離線緩存的網(wǎng)頁_訪問已緩存的離線頁面內(nèi)容
閱讀:897 · 9分鐘前
-
VSCode后端:REST API調(diào)試技巧
閱讀:437 · 10分鐘前
-
通義千問平臺(tái)鏈接 通義千問官網(wǎng)在線入口
閱讀:870 · 10分鐘前
-
composer如何處理符號(hào)鏈接(symlink)的包
閱讀:361 · 11分鐘前
-
WPS表格如何篩選數(shù)據(jù)_WPS表格數(shù)據(jù)篩選與高級(jí)篩選設(shè)置
閱讀:804 · 11分鐘前